Output 2437866c948455fcbfe6f124f470d5a658472eaa989bf1f2c559e461580963e8:0

value
3040000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86a1b5ba97589c448fb2d90aed7cb129082e5e6a OP_EQUAL
address
3DxtC3kvySVExSXhsEmJ7YQfefwoQd2AjW
transaction
2437866c948455fcbfe6f124f470d5a658472eaa989bf1f2c559e461580963e8
spent
true